Transaction 35ee2c1921003624fa50cbf9ef4dd27b4b779aeb23ee685dfa36a39a1b67ece5

63 Input
2 Outputs
  • 35ee2c1921003624fa50cbf9ef4dd27b4b779aeb23ee685dfa36a39a1b67ece5:0
  • value  401924781
    address  3KgKG3Jq5QRfMtBfAymZLzZ62VT5e26a8m
  • 35ee2c1921003624fa50cbf9ef4dd27b4b779aeb23ee685dfa36a39a1b67ece5:1
  • value  703918
    address  32dhSDajw83sHhbngkzBN5uuqSVtincySw